About 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th

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th is a debt fund. This fund was started on 1 January, 2013. The fund is managed by Manish Banthia, Ritesh Lunawat. This fund is suitable to keep your money safe.

Key Parameters

  1. 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th has ₹13017 Cr worth of assets under management (AUM) as on Dec 1969 and is more than category average.
  2. The fund has an expense ratio 0.4.

Returns

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th has given a CAGR return of 8.06% since inception. Over the last 1, 3 and 5 years the fund has given a CAGR return of 7.81%, 7.08% and 6.49% respectively.

Taxation

As it is a ultra short duration mutual fund the taxation is as follows:
If the fund is debt oriented i.e. asset allocation of more than 65% in debt instruments:
Invested before 1 April 2023 and held for less than 24 months, STCG will be taxed at your income slab rate.
Invested before 1 April 2023 and held for more than 24 months, LTCG will be taxed at 12.5%.
Invested after 1 April 2023, capital gains will be taxed at your income slab rate.
Dividends will always be taxed at slab rate.

Investment objective of 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th

To generate income through investments in a range of debt and money market instruments. However, there can be no assurance or guarantee that the investment objective of the Scheme would be achieved.

Minimum Investment and lockin period

Minimum investment for lump sum payment is INR 5000.00 and for SIP is INR 1000.00. ICICI Prudential Ultra Short Term Fund Direct Growth has no lock in period.

Yield to Maturity is 7.74 as on March 2025. Yield to Maturity is the total return earned on your bond investments if you hold the bond investments till maturity & all bonds' proceeds are reinvested in it.
Modified Duration is 0.42 as on March 2025. Modified Duration tells the sensitivity of the price of a bond to a change in interest rate.
